Re: Megane II CC Brake Light

you dont need to remove the boot lining at all there are two thumb screws behind the light just unscrew them and the whole light unit will come off and change the bulb

Re: Steering Lock on fault - take care or it can be expensiv

I had the same problem, my lock stayed on and would not come off what so ever. The bolt is actually designed so that it can not be removed from the lock while it is locked which is why the dealers are saying to replace the whole steering column. The steering locked can not be used on another vehicle...
